Transaction 52ddecf663999116315ecdc26916993cc895b5cdcef5ec48a0bc29f642f0c7a5

1 Input
2 Outputs
  • 52ddecf663999116315ecdc26916993cc895b5cdcef5ec48a0bc29f642f0c7a5:0
  • value  2075148111
    address  tb1qg5ljw9wv3z0vurkeqpwr8nwy98cd0sldjwgexw
  • 52ddecf663999116315ecdc26916993cc895b5cdcef5ec48a0bc29f642f0c7a5:1
  • value  61963
    address  tb1q45mn44r5ugqnmnqwjmaauzzucppysf6vmr9pfd